Gorilla Gold Mines Ltd has raised A$31.7 million through a placement to accelerate exploration and resource growth at its key Western Australian gold projects. The capital injection strengthens the company’s cash position to about A$42 million, supporting ongoing and planned drilling campaigns.

Apiam Animal Health Limited has entered a binding agreement with Adamantem Capital Fund II for a $228.4 million acquisition via a scheme of arrangement, offering shareholders a significant premium and flexible cash or scrip consideration options.

Credit Clear Limited has agreed to acquire UK debt collector ARC Europe for A$10.9 million, backed by a $20.75 million institutional placement led by Chair Paul Dwyer. The deal aims to accelerate growth by integrating Credit Clear’s digital platform into ARC’s established UK operations.

TZ Limited has turned down a non-binding offer from Quadient SA for its US Smart Locker subsidiary, Telezygology Inc., citing undervaluation and strategic importance of its Data Centre Security division. The company is now initiating a strategic review to explore future options for the business.
